Relative Search:
Baidu Google
Edit this listing

Higher Image Inc

7540 W McNab Rd Ste E18
North Lauderdale , FL 33068
954-720-5227

Driving Directions

From:
To: 7540 W McNab Rd Ste E18 ,North Lauderdale , FL 33068